The deformation cohomology of a tensor category controls deformations
of its associativity constraint.
Here we deal with the deformation cohomology of tensor categories
generated by one object. In the case when all morphisms are
endomorphisms such categories are completely described by sequences of
algebras (the so-called Schur-Weyl categories).
The deformation complex of a Schur-Weyl category has an explicit
description in terms of the corresponding sequence of algebras.
This approach is convenient for computing the deformation cohomology
of free symmetric tensor categories.
We compare the answers with the exterior invariants of the general
linear Lie algebra.
The results make precise an intriguing connection between the
combinatorics of partitions and invariants of the exterior powers of
the general linear algebra observed by Kostant.
Another example is the Schur-Weyl category of the sequences of
degenerate affine Hecke algebras. The deformation cohomology of this
category coincides with the deformation cohomology of the free
symmetric tensor category of one object with an endomorphism. |
